Responsibilities & Expectations: 

We are looking for an enthusiastic Utility Operator to join our team. As an Utility Operator for IPS, it is important that you are up to the task of cleaning, stripping and painting AC/DC motor parts during the disassembly and assembly stages of the repair process. You will use a variety of equipment to clean internal and external motor parts and distribute them where necessary in the service center. You will work especially close with the winding department while sand blasting. It is required that you follow all safety procedures and wear the necessary Personal Protective Equipment when applicable.    

  • Cleans internal and external parts of motors, frames, cores, armatures, gears, housings and other equipment for repair 
  • Operate cleaning equipment including but not limited to: steam cleaner, parts washers, sand-blaster, etc. 
  • Operate specialized repair equipment including but not limited to: dip tanks, VPI systems and controlled temperature burnout and bake-out ovens as well as various handheld power and non-power tools  
  • Clean internal and external parts of motors to include frames, cores, armatures, gears, housings and other equipment for repair 
  • Operate material handling equipment such as fork truck and cranes, etc., to aid in delivering or storing motors and parts 
  • Paint repaired assembled motors before shipped back to the customer 
  • Observe all safety procedures and use proper protective gear. Maintain housekeeping in assigned area

Excellence in creating innovative solutions for the supply, control and use of energy. Tampa Armature Works Inc. is a family of integrated power solutions. TAW product lines and services are as diverse as the customers and industries that utilize them. Since 1921, TAW has been the premier Sales, Service, and Predictive Maintenance provider for electric motors, generators, transformers, pumps, drives, metal clad switchgear, metal-enclosed switchgear, and all rotating apparatus. If it spins, turns or rotates, chances are we can repair it, rewind it or rebuild it better than anyone else. From the distribution of KOHLER generators to custom engineered switchgear, generator packaging, power controls and automation to power distribution equipment, motor repair, and service of all kinds of equipment — including wind and nuclear power — TAW creates integrated power solutions across many different platforms.
